Stem Cell Treatment for Shoulder Pain: Platelet Rich Plasma (PRP)
As patients strive for more innovative treatments for persistent shoulder pain, regenerative therapies are gaining more attention. Shoulder pain may persist despite surgical intervention – which is often the reason for surgery in the first place. This has led many patients to seek alternative measures to treat their shoulder pain. Rotator cuff problems and shoulder joint arthritis are two frequent reasons patients consult Dennis M. Lox, M.D., a Sports and Regenerative Medicine Specialist. Dr. Lox has treated many patients with chronic shoulder problems with Platelet Rich Plasma (PRP) and Stem Cell Therapy. Dr. Lox notes many patients are now considering regenerative medicine as alternatives to surgery, especially shoulder joint replacement. Being able to treat shoulder pain with conservative measures that focus on healing and regeneration is appealing to many patients.
